3. Princess Anne’s Alleged Affair with Her Bodyguard
Peter Cross, a former royal protection officer, once claimed to have had an affair with Princess Anne during her marriage to Phillips. “She made all the running in our friendship,” Cross revealed about the affair that reportedly began in August 1980.
Initially assigned to protect the Princess at Gatcombe Park in 1979, he later admitted that their relationship grew intimate, despite both being married at the time.

Cross disclosed that their bond developed through late-night conversations and moments of vulnerability, particularly when Anne felt isolated due to her husband’s frequent absences.
Peter Cross’s ex-wife, Linda, provided a candid perspective on his infidelity with Princess Anne. She described her husband as a man who couldn’t resist women and noted that they were often drawn to him as well.

Throughout their marriage, Linda had encountered two of his girlfriends, who showed up at their doorstep in tears. However, when it came to his involvement with Princess Anne, Linda recognized that this affair was different.
She acknowledged that he was “playing with fire” and could get “seriously burnt.” Cross publicly confirmed the affair in 1985, after leaving the police force and transitioning to a career in insurance.
His relationship with the Princess reportedly continued even after he was reassigned from royal duties, with Anne maintaining contact through secretive phone calls and private meetings.
Cross’s former partner, Gillian Nicholls, noted that the affair cast a shadow over their relationship, as the Princess’ presence loomed in the background.

Despite the scandal, Anne’s marriage to Phillips initially endured, though it eventually ended. Cross himself remarried and started a family, but his connection to the Princess remained a significant chapter of his life, one that was later revisited in media portrayals like “The Crown.”

5. Princess Anne’s Past Romance with Queen Camilla’s Former Husband
Princess Anne shares a close bond with her sister-in-law, Queen Camilla, who has been married to King Charles III since 2005. However, their families have long been connected.
Camilla’s first husband, Andrew Parker Bowles, was once romantically involved with Princess Anne. Anne and Andrew began dating in 1970, but their relationship never became serious due to his Catholic faith, which made marriage unlikely.

Despite the end of their romance, Anne and Andrew have remained on very good terms; he is even the godfather of her daughter, Zara Tindall. They frequently reconnect at horse racing events, where their shared love of horses continues to bring them together.
